POC VS MVP: CHỌN CÁCH TIẾP CẬN NÀO ĐỂ TẠO RA MỘT SẢN PHẨM PHẦN MỀM TUYỆT VỜI
Trước khi tạo ra một sản phẩm phần mềm hoặc triển khai một tính năng mới, chúng ta cần kiểm tra nó. Cách tốt nhất để làm điều đó là kiểm tra ý tưởng bằng các phương pháp thích hợp như: PoC, prototype, MVP,… Tech Town đã thông tin đến bạn về sự khác nhau giữa prototype và MVP. Trong bài viết này, chúng ta sẽ nói về PoC và MVP.
PoC là gì?
Khái niệm PoC
Proof of Concept hoặc PoC là một dự án nhỏ được thiết kế để xác minh một ý tưởng là cụ thể và khả thi. Thông thường, các doanh nghiệp phát triển PoC là để thử nghiệm nội bộ. Nhiều lĩnh vực khác sử dụng nó để kiểm tra những đổi mới của họ.
Mục đích của PoC
PoC tập trung vào việc chứng minh liệu chức năng này có thể phát triển được trong thế giới thực hay không. Nó cũng chỉ ra những trở ngại tiềm ẩn của việc phát triển sản phẩm và có được người dùng chấp nhận hay không. Bảng thiết kế PoC cuối cùng không hoàn hảo, nhưng nó sẽ thể hiện khả năng tồn tại của một khái niệm trước khi bắt đầu phát triển.
PoC trả lời được các câu hỏi:
- Dự án giải quyết vấn đề gì?
- Phạm vi của dự án?
- Những công nghệ nào nên được lựa chọn?
- Thời gian và ngân sách cho dự án?
- Phản hồi từ các bên liên quan?
Việc startups kiểm tra giải pháp với PoC sẽ giúp các bạn hiểu giá trị của nó đối với người dùng thực tế trong thời gian sớm nhất. Cho dù đối với một tính năng hay một sản phẩm, PoC đều đưa ra đề xuất về công nghệ, ngân sách và thời gian để phát triển nó. Điều này giúp startups hoạch định chiến lược kinh doanh của mình với chức năng đã chọn.
MVP là gì?
Khái niệm MVP
Minimum Viable Product (MVP) là phiên bản sản phẩm ban đầu bao gồm các tính năng cốt lõi được yêu cầu. Phiên bản này mang lại đủ giá trị để nhận được phản hồi sớm từ khách hàng trước khi startups dành hàng tấn thời gian để phát triển một thức gì đó mà khách hàng không thích hoặc không cần.
Mục đích của MVP
MVP là phiên bản sản phẩm mà khách hàng tiềm năng có thể sử dụng. Nó không phải là một sản phẩm thô – thiếu các tính năng, mà là một hình thức mô tả sớm giải pháp của startups và có thể phát triển thêm tính năng trong tương lai.
MVP có thể được tung ra thị trường. Vì vậy nó không phải là một mẫu thử nghiệm chỉ được sử dụng bởi nhóm phát triển, mà để bán cho khách hàng thực sự.
MVP cung cấp cho startups thông tin về cách khách hàng tiềm năng chấp nhận sản phẩm của các bạn. Người dùng có thể dùng thử, nếu họ thích, họ sẽ làm cho giải pháp đó phổ biến. Sau đó, startups có thể quyết định xem có nên tiến xa hơn với các tính năng bổ sung hay cải tiến MVP của mình hay không.
Ví dụ, trước khi phát hành sản phẩm toàn cầu, một công ty có thể tung ra MVP cho một khu vực cụ thể. Khi nhận được phản hồi tích cực từ người dùng, công ty có thể mở rộng ra các quốc gia khác. Cách làm này giúp tiết kiệm chi phí, thử nghiệm ý tưởng và khởi chạy một cách nhanh chóng.
Một MVP có cấu trúc module. Vì vậy, đội ngũ phát triển có thể dễ dàng loại bỏ các yếu tố không cần thiết và các nhược điểm khác trong sản phẩm. Điều này giúp cải thiện hành trình của người dùng.
So sánh giữa PoC và MVP
Sự khác biệt giữa PoC và MVP là chúng phục vụ cho các mục đích khác nhau. Trong khi PoC cung cấp cơ sở lý thuyết cho một ý tưởng về một giải pháp hoặc một chức năng cụ thể, thì MVP thực hiện các tính năng được thiết kế ở các giai đoạn PoC và prototype.
Có thể hình dung PoC giống như bản phác thảo ý tưởng, còn MVP là hiện thực hóa ý tưởng. PoC phác thảo các công nghệ cho một giải pháp và khám phá những rủi ro và vấn đề kỹ thuật có thể xảy ra của ý tưởng. Nó phân tích nhu cầu thị trường tiềm năng. Ngược lại, MVP được tạo ra để kiểm tra xem thị trường phản ứng như thế nào với giải pháp.
Nên chọn PoC khi nào?
Startups sẽ cảm thấy nên bỏ qua giai đoạn này để tiết kiệm thời gian, nhưng PoC thực sự rất quan trọng cho dự án phát triển sản phẩm. Nó làm nổi bật các khía cạnh thiết yếu của ý tưởng như: Có thể thực hiện các tính năng như đã dự định? Thách thức là gì? Doanh thu sẽ là bao nhiêu?
Trả lời được những câu hỏi trên là rất quan trọng trước khi biến ý tưởng của các bạn thành hiện thực.
Tech Town khuyên startups nên chọn PoC khi:
Startups phải kiểm tra xem giải pháp của các bạn có thể hoạt động trong đời thực hay không.
Các startups thương tin rằng ý tưởng của các bạn sẽ thay đổi thế giới này theo cách tốt đẹp hơn và giải quyết được vấn đề của đối tượng mục tiêu. Vậy thì PoC sẽ giúp các bạn khám phá xem liệu ý tưởng đó có thể thành hiện thực hay không. Nếu ý tưởng đó có vẻ không khả thi, startups có thể dễ dàng tìm ra giải pháp ở các giai đoạn PoC sau.
Startups muốn mang lại giá trị mới
PoC giúp các bạn phân biệt giải pháp của mình với của các nhà cung cấp tương tự, ví dụ như sản phẩm giống như những gì các bạn muốn xây dựng đã đạt thành công, hay như một ứng dụng nhắn tin đang có vô số nhà cung cấp trên thị trường. Vì vậy, tốt nhất startups nên có một PoC thể hiện chức năng độc đáo và tạo sự khác biệt cho sản phẩm của các bạn so với các giải pháp tương tự.
Startups muốn nhận được tài trợ
Trước khi yêu cầu nguồn tài trợ, startups cần chứng minh với các nhà đầu tư tiềm năng rằng đổ vốn vào dự án của các bạn là điều xứng đáng. PoC có thể bao gồm mô tả ý nghĩa cốt lõi của dự án và giải thích được ý tưởng này là thực tế và mang lại lợi nhuận. Tất cả những điều này sẽ giúp các bạn thuyết phục các nhà đầu tư đóng góp vào dự án.
Startups cần đánh giá rủi ro
Khi startups phát hiện ra một tính năng hoặc giải pháp, PoC sẽ xác định chính xác những rủi ro và trở ngại tiềm ẩn. Điều này rất cần thiết cho các dự án lớn với vốn đầu tư cao. PoC đảm bảo các bạn không vượt quá ngân sách và thời gian, đồng thời cũng đảm bảo các tính năng sẽ hoạt động tốt.
Nên chọn MVP khi nào
Khi đã chứng minh được ý tưởng sản phẩm của mình và phác thảo thiết kế sơ bộ trong PoC. Bây giờ, startups đã có thể phát triển chức năng cho giải pháp của mình dưới dạng MVP.
MVP cho phép startups phát hành sản phẩm của mình càng sớm càng tốt chỉ với các tính năng cốt lõi. Giải pháp của các bạn không có nhiều chức năng, nhưng chúng đủ để bán sản phẩm trên thị trường. Qua đó, startups có thể thiết lập sớm mối quan hệ với người dùng tiềm năng. Nếu họ thích MVP của các bạn, việc tiếp tục phát triển nó là rất đáng để nỗ lực.
Chọn MVP khi:
Startups muốn giảm thiểu và tối ưu hóa chi phí.
Một MVP bao gồm các tính năng quan trọng tối thiểu, vì thế nên nhóm phát triển sẽ tốn ít thời gian hơn để phát triển dự án cho startups. Điều này giúp tiết kiệm nguồn lực và chi phí cần thiết cho việc phát triển sản phẩm phần mềm.
Startups muốn nhận phản hồi từ những người dùng chấp nhận sản phẩm sớm
MVP đề xuất giá trị cốt lõi cho người dùng. Việc tung ra một MVP cho thấy liệu sản phẩm của startups có đáp ứng được nhu cầu cụ thể của người dùng hay không. Phản hồi từ họ cho phép các bạn kiểm tra các giả định của mình. Sau đó, startups có thể quyết định nên tiến hành lặp lại các tính năng hay hoàn thiện sản phẩm của mình.
Startups muốn tìm hiểu những gì phù hợp với thị trường mục tiêu
MVP đòi hỏi ít nỗ lực và tính năng để gia nhập thị trường. Startups không cần phải phát triển một giải pháp hoàn chỉnh cho người dùng tiềm năng, nhưng nó phải chứa đủ các yếu tố cần thiết. Người dùng có thể đưa ra phản hồi về sản phẩm mà họ đã trải nghiệm. Biết được phản ứng của thị trường, startups có thể ứng biến trong sản phẩm của mình.
Kết luận
Khi đưa ra một ý tưởng, startups cần thử nghiệm nó một cách tự nhiên. Đây là cách mà PoC và MVP có thể giúp các bạn. Cả hai cách tiếp cận đều cho phép các bạn kiểm tra lý thuyết của mình và nhận được phản hồi sớm. Sự khác biệt giữa PoC và MVP cũng giống như bản nháp và dự án đã thực hiện.
Với PoC, startups có thể kiểm tra tính khả thi của ý tưởng. Trong khi đó, việc xây dựng MVP là tạo ra một giải pháp đã sẵn sàng để tung ra thị trường, mang lại cho các bạn phản hồi sớm từ những người dùng đầu tiên.
Cả hai giai đoạn đều rất cần thiết để xây dựng một sản phẩm phù hợp với nhu cầu thị trường và có thể mở rộng quy mô một cách linh hoạt trong tương lai.
Hy vọng những thông tin Tech Town mang đến sẽ hữu ích đối với bạn.
Tech Town biết cách để biến ý tưởng của bạn thành sự thật. Hãy liên hệ với chúng tôi để thảo luận về ý tưởng của bạn.